Cressie May Hoopes

1931-2025
Cressie May Hoopes, 93, of Salem passed away peacefully on March 27, 2025 surrounded by her loving family.
Cressie was born on November 24, 1931 in Alliance to William H. and Ehrma (Wolfe) Wharton. She was the organist at multiple churches, with Beechwood United Methodist Church, being her last, retiring after 70 years. Cressie was a member of Eastern Star (North Canton Legacy #596), Farm Bureau of Columbiana County and the Duo Decum Club. She enjoyed baking, canning and spending time with family and friends.
